IISP & CESG Certified IA Professional Certification
Amethyst is working closely with the Institute of Information Security Professionals (IISP) to align the training courses with their Security Skills Framework and achieve IISP certification.
The training courses aim to provide knowledge and understanding at IISP Level 1 (Awareness) as defined in the IISP Framework
(Note this link to content from the IISP website opens in new window).
Level 1 - Awareness: Understands the skill and its application. Has acquired and can demonstrate basic knowledge associated with the skill. Understands how the skill should be applied but may have no practical experience of its application.
Candidates seeking to achieve CESG Certification for IA Specialists through the CESG Certified Professional Scheme (CCP) should note that both IISP and other Certification Bodies for the Scheme will require evidence that the information and knowledge presented on these courses has been assimilated. Moreover, evidence of practical implementation of some of the knowledge gained in some of the Skill Groups will be required for both IISP membership and certification for selected roles under the CCP Scheme; for the CCP Scheme the Skill Groups requiring practical experience will be determined by the CCP Role(s) selected.
